Richard Branson’s Virgin Orbit Reaches Space With Unconventional Rocket-Launch System
Startup deploys tiny satellites into orbit in successful demonstration flight

A venture to launch small satellites using a rocket fired from a converted jumbo jet deployed 10 tiny ones into orbit for the first time Sunday, providing a big boost for the startup founded by entrepreneur Richard Branson.

The successful demonstration flight by Southern-California-based Virgin Orbit, nearly eight months after a botched test, lifts the company into the select group of small-satellite launch providers able to offer flight-proven hardware.

With the proliferation of small-satellite manufacturers across the U.S. and other regions, specialized launch providers are rushing to fill the demand to blast their products into space. They include Rocket Lab, a U.S.-New Zealand company that has a flight-proven rocket; Texas-based Firefly Aerospace; and Relativity Space, which plans to launch 3-D manufactured rockets. But only a few of the startups can claim the distinction of blasting out of the atmosphere, a goal Mr. Branson and his team have pursued for years, even as more-conventional rocket designs grabbed most of the public attention.

Virgin Orbit’s novel airborne platform, a specially outfitted Boeing Co. 747 jet named Cosmic Girl, climbed to an altitude of roughly 6 miles above the Pacific Ocean and released a slender, 70-foot rocket slung under its left wing. The booster’s main liquid-fueled engine roared to life, transporting the cluster of cubesats, or miniature satellites, built by universities and sponsored by the National Aeronautics and Space Administration, into low-Earth orbit.

Mr. Branson said the company’s LauncherOne rocket would encourage “a whole new generation of innovators on the path to orbit.” Virgin Orbit CEO Dan Hart said the company managed to demonstrate every element of its launch system. The next mission is slated to begin commercial operations, with customers including the U.K.’s Air Force and low-cost communications provider Swarm Technologies Inc.

It is a fraught time for the host of launch companies world-wide seeking to cash in on the exponential growth of small satellites designed for tasks including earth observation, industrial uses and climate studies. Dozens of other companies targeting the same expanding market have suffered funding problems or delays getting launchers airborne in the past year, partly as a result of the Covid-19 pandemic, according to U.S. government and industry officials.

Commercial customers and the U.S. military are looking more to benefit from the lower costs and increased flexibility of small rockets able to put satellites weighing from a few pounds to a few hundred pounds into tailored orbits. Placing such satellites as secondary payloads on larger boosters—essentially piggybacking them on larger satellites—often means customers can’t depend on optimum schedules or orbital locations. The result can fray business plans and reduce the useful life of satellites

Despite the small-satellite trend, some industry players see some rockets carrying many at a time and, therefore, potentially producing a glut of launch providers. “I don’t see that demand is going to increase dramatically over the next few years,” said George Stafford, a co-founder of small-satellite maker Blue Canyon Technologies, recently acquired by Raytheon Technologies Corp.

Regardless of industry expansion, it will take time for Virgin Orbit’s approach to shake up the launch business. The sister company of Virgin Galactic, SPCE -7.87% a space-tourism venture also founded by Mr. Branson, has said it expects to increase launches slowly, with only a few likely for all of 2021. Virgin Orbit initially marketed a price of $12 million for a launch, versus roughly five times that much for significantly larger rockets, such as the Falcon 9 operated by Elon Musk’s Space Exploration Technologies Corp., or SpaceX.
